Vulnerability Details : CVE-2002-1628
Directory traversal vulnerability in vote.cgi for Mike Spice Mike's Vote CGI before 1.3 allows remote attackers to write arbitrary files via .. (dot dot) sequences in the type parameter.
Vulnerability category: Directory traversal
